Executive Safeguarding Leadership Placements

We specialise in finding exceptional permanent leaders who can shape and champion your safeguarding culture from the top. Our service covers roles such as Head of Safeguarding, Director of Safeguarding and Quality, and designated Trustee positions with safeguarding oversight. Every search begins with a detailed analysis of your charity’s mission, values and the specific safeguarding challenges facing the communities you serve in Crosby. We then access a carefully curated talent pool of professionals who combine strategic leadership ability with hands on experience of managing complex cases, conducting Section 42 enquiries and leading cultural change.

Board-Level Safeguarding Advisory Appointments

Effective governance is the bedrock of safe organisations, and we help third sector boards in Crosby strengthen their oversight capabilities. We place trustees and non executive directors with specific safeguarding responsibilities, ensuring boards have the right mix of lived experience, legal knowledge and strategic insight. Our process helps you define the precise governance gap you need to fill, then we source individuals who understand both the statutory framework and the relational nature of safeguarding in a charity context. This service gives your organisation the leadership it needs to meet the Charity Governance Code and public expectations.
